Does Potomac River water damage my plumbing fixtures?

Potomac River water has high mineral content, leading to hard water scaling throughout your plumbing system. This scale buildup reduces flow in faucets and showerheads, decreases water heater efficiency by insulating heating elements, and causes premature failure of appliances like dishwashers. Installing a water softener or using descaling treatments can extend the life of your fixtures and reduce energy costs.

What should I do before spring thaw to avoid plumbing problems?

Temperate climates here experience spring thaws after winter lows around 28°F, which can shift soil and stress pipes. A pro-tip is to inspect exposed pipes in basements and crawl spaces for cracks or loose fittings before thaw begins. Ensure outdoor spigots are properly drained and insulated, as residual ice can cause backflow issues. Scheduling a pre-thaw maintenance check helps identify vulnerabilities before they become emergencies.

Could the hilly landscape near Kensington Historic District affect my drainage?

Hilly terrain in this area creates uneven stress on main sewer lines and drainage systems. Gravity pulls wastewater downhill, but soil erosion on slopes can expose or damage pipes, leading to leaks or blockages. Properties on inclines often experience slower drainage in lower sections, requiring properly graded lines to prevent backups. Regular inspections of exterior drainage paths help mitigate these terrain-related issues.

Why do my older pipes keep springing small leaks?

Galvanized steel pipes from the 1950s develop pinhole leaks due to internal corrosion and joint calcification. As the zinc coating wears away over decades, the underlying steel rusts unevenly, creating weak spots that fail under normal water pressure. These leaks often start in hidden areas like crawl spaces or behind walls, requiring professional detection and replacement with modern materials like copper or PEX.

As a suburban homeowner, what unique plumbing issues should I watch for?

Suburban settings like North Kensington connect to municipal water systems with consistent pressure, which can stress older galvanized pipes over time. Tree roots from mature landscaping often invade lateral sewer lines, causing slow drains or blockages that require hydro-jetting. Unlike rural areas with wells, here you’ll deal with public water quality factors like chlorine levels affecting pipe corrosion. Maintaining cleanouts and monitoring pressure regulators helps manage these suburban-specific challenges.
